Best Ways To Find Books Of Power In Stardew Valley

three book of power in stardew valley.

There are at least five proven methods for obtaining Power Books: Buying them from shopkeepers, earning them as rewards, looting them from hidden and mystery boxes, extracting them from artifact spots, and retrieving them from monster drops. How To Get Every Book Of Power In Stardew Valley

Book Seller in Stardew Valley


Out of the 19 Books of Power, 13 can be bought from the Bookseller, Dwarves, or Marnie. The rest are rare drops, secret collectibles, or quest prizes.

Here’s how to obtain every Book of Power in Stardew Valley 1.6:

Woody’s Secret

This Power Book increases the chance of getting double drops from fallen trees by 5%. To obtain it, you must keep chopping trees. (It is a random drop that cannot be triggered by any specific action other than cutting trees.)

Raccoon Journal

When you read the Raccoon Journal, you have a greater chance of getting mixed seeds from weeds. To unlock the Raccoon Journal, you must complete the second Raccoon Request, which is accessible after completing the Giant Stump Quest.

The Diamond Hunter

When you absorb the knowledge of The Diamond Hunter, you can extract Diamonds from any rock and node. If you want to access this unique Book of Power, you must pay ten Diamonds to the Dwarf in the Volcano Dungeon. (This is not to be confused with The Mines’ Dwarf.)


The Art O’ Crabbing

The spells in this book increase double gains from Crab Pots by 25%. You can unlock The Art O’ Crabbing by catching eight Squids during the SquidFest.

The Alleyway Buffet

Reading The Alleyway Buffet increases your chances of finding items in trash cans. To get this Book of Power, you must loot the Golden Trash Can. It can be found in the secret area between the Blacksmith and JojaMart. (Look for a hidden path in the fences.)

Monsters Compendium

After reading Monsters Compendium, creatures have a higher chance of dropping double loot. This item is unlocked by defeating monsters in dungeons. While there’s no guaranteed method to obtain it, any creature in the Mines has the potential to drop it.

Mapping Cave Systems

If you read Mapping Cave Systems, Marlon’s item retrieval service will cost 50% less. You get this Book of Power by slaying 1,000 monsters and accessing the backroom in the Adventurer’s Guild.


Book of Mysteries

Readers have a greater chance of finding Mystery Boxes. To get the Book of Mysteries, you must break Mystery Boxes (gold or regular) open.

Animal Catalogue

After reading the Animal Catalogue, Marnie’s Shop becomes accessible even when she’s away. To get his Power Book, pay Marnie 5,000g.

Dwarvish Safety Manual

This Power Book reduces the damage of bombs by 25%. To unlock the Dwarvish Safety Manual, pay the Dwarf in the Mines 4,000g.

Friendship 101

Friendship 101 accelerates the process of befriending villagers. You can purchase this book fromthe Bookseller for 20,000g or win it as a prize from Lewis’ Prize Machine.

Horse: The Book

The reader’s horse becomes faster. If you want to get Horse: The Book, you must pay the Bookseller 25,000g.

Jack Be Nimble, Jack Be Thick

Jack Be Nimble, Jack Be Thick is a Book of Power that grants a permanent +1 Defense buff. You can either buy it from the Bookseller for 20,000g or extract it from Artifact Spots.

Jewels of the Sea

After reading this book, you might get Roe from Fishing Treasures. To get the Jewels of the Sea, you must visit the Bookseller. (The price tag is 20,000g.) If you are lucky, you might also find a version in a chest while fishing.


Ol’ Slitherlegs

Ol’ Slitherlegs readers walk and run faster through crops and vegetation. The Bookseller offers this Power Book at a price of 25,000g.

Price Catalogue

The Price Catalogue is a Book of Power that shows the selling price of your items. To unlock it, you must pay the Bookseller 3,000g.

Queen of Sauce Cookbook

This cookbook teaches you all Queen of Sauce recipes. You can purchase the Queen of Sauce Cookbook from the Bookseller for 50,000g.

Treasure Appraisal Guide

If you read the Treasure Appraisal Guide, you can sell artifacts at a higher price. There are two ways to obtain this Power Book: 1) You can purchase it from the Bookseller for 20,000g, and 2) You might extract it from Mystery Boxes or Artifact Troves.

Way Of The Wind (pt. 1 & 2)

Reading Way Of The Wind accelerates your character’s movement. The Bookseller sells the first part for 15,000g. After unlocking the first edition, you can purchase the second book for 35,000g.

The Bookseller’s inventory rotates every time they visit the town. Check back every time to ensure you have purchased all their Books of Power.
